Do you want to work on real-world deployments of cutting-edge machine learning models, including Large Language Models (LLMs)?

Aveni is redefining how AI works for financial services. Our purpose-built, vertically integrated platform combines proprietary Language Models (FinLLM), intelligent AI Agents, and targeted solutions like Aveni Assist and Aveni Detect. We partner with leading financial institutions to deliver scalable, secure, and compliant AI-powered solutions that create measurable value across advice, compliance, and operations.

We're looking for a motivated Senior DevOps Engineer, eager to help us deploy and maintain machine learning models, especially Large Language Models (LLMs), in production environments. If you have solid DevOps experience and are keen to grow your MLOps skills, we'd love to hear from you!

What You'll Be Doing:

  • Automating Machine Learning workflows (training * deployment) with AWS & GitOps
  • Deploying LLMs using Kubernetes & Docker
  • Building infrastructure with Terraform & Helm
  • Monitoring and maintaining ML models with performance alerts and dashboards
  • Supporting CI/CD for ML pipelines
  • Developing production-grade APIs (REST/gRPC) to serve models
